The Betem 24 Colors Dual Tip Acrylic Paint Pens are a versatile option for artists and DIY enthusiasts alike. They feature a dual tip design with a 1-5mm round nib for broader strokes and a 1mm fine nib for intricate detailing. This flexibility makes them suitable for various projects, whether you're working on rocks, canvas, or other surfaces. The markers come in a vibrant array of 24 colors, providing plenty of options for creativity and color mixing.

One of the standout features is the upgraded cotton nibs, which dry quickly and enhance the painting experience compared to ordinary push-type pens. The high-quality, water-based ink is odorless and acid-free, ensuring that it is safe to use while maintaining strong opacity and long-lasting results. This makes them ideal not just for personal projects but also for gifting to friends and family who enjoy crafts.

The markers require proper care, such as tightening the caps and storing them horizontally when not in use, to prevent them from drying out. While they work on a wide range of surfaces, some users may find the ink performance varies slightly depending on the material used. Additionally, their drying time, while faster than some other markers, may still be slower than expected for rapid projects.

The SHARPIE Creative Markers Variety Pack offers a versatile set of water-based acrylic markers that cater primarily to adult crafters and artists. With an assortment of 24 colors, including unique earth tones, this set provides a wide range of vibrant hues that work well on both light and dark surfaces. The ink is designed not to bleed through paper, making these markers suitable for various materials such as metal, wood, ceramic, glass, rock, and canvas.

A significant feature of these markers is their paint-like ink, which allows for bold markings without the need to shake the marker before use. This convenience factor is complemented by the ability to layer colors beautifully, which could be a major advantage for those interested in complex art projects or crafts. However, the bold point type may not be ideal for detailed work or fine outlines, so users seeking precision might need additional tools.

In terms of drying time, the markers dry relatively quickly, reducing the risk of smudging, which is a valuable trait for projects requiring quick handling or layering. However, the opacity of the colors can vary; some lighter shades may require multiple layers to achieve full coverage, especially on darker surfaces.

Durability appears to be strong with these markers, as they perform well across a range of materials. Still, it's recommended to store them horizontally to maintain ink flow and longevity effectively.

Given their varied tip sizes and bold color payoff, these markers are excellent for adults looking for a reliable medium for creative projects. While they may not be suited for intricate detailing, their ease of use and broad color spectrum make them a popular choice in the arts and crafts community.

Buying Guide for the Best Paint Markers

Choosing the right paint markers can make a significant difference in your art projects, DIY crafts, or professional work. Paint markers are versatile tools that can be used on various surfaces such as paper, wood, metal, glass, and fabric. To find the best fit for your needs, it's important to understand the key specifications and how they impact the performance and suitability of the markers for your specific tasks.
Tip SizeThe tip size of a paint marker determines the thickness of the lines it can produce. This is important because different projects require different levels of detail. Fine tips (0.5-1mm) are great for detailed work and writing, medium tips (1-3mm) are versatile for both detail and filling in larger areas, and broad tips (3mm and above) are ideal for covering large surfaces quickly. Choose a tip size based on the precision and coverage you need for your project.
Ink TypePaint markers come with different types of ink, such as water-based, oil-based, and acrylic. Water-based inks are easy to clean and suitable for indoor projects, but they may not be as durable on non-porous surfaces. Oil-based inks are more permanent and can adhere to a variety of surfaces, making them ideal for outdoor use and projects that require durability. Acrylic inks offer vibrant colors and are versatile for both indoor and outdoor use. Consider the surface you will be working on and the longevity you need when choosing the ink type.
Color RangeThe color range available in paint markers can vary significantly. Some sets offer a limited palette of basic colors, while others provide a wide array of shades and tones. If your project requires specific colors or a broad spectrum, look for markers that offer a wide color range. For general use, a basic set with primary and secondary colors may suffice. Think about the color needs of your project and whether you need a wide variety or just a few key colors.
OpacityOpacity refers to how well the paint covers the surface without showing the underlying material. High-opacity markers provide solid, vibrant colors that can cover dark surfaces effectively, while low-opacity markers may require multiple layers to achieve the desired effect. If you need strong, bold colors that stand out, opt for high-opacity markers. For more subtle or layered effects, lower opacity markers might be suitable.
Drying TimeThe drying time of paint markers can vary, affecting how quickly you can handle or layer your work. Fast-drying markers are convenient for quick projects and layering without smudging, while slower-drying markers may allow for blending and adjustments before the paint sets. Consider your working style and the demands of your project when choosing markers with the appropriate drying time.
DurabilityDurability refers to how well the paint withstands wear, weather, and washing. This is particularly important for projects that will be exposed to the elements or frequent handling. Oil-based and acrylic markers tend to offer higher durability compared to water-based markers. Assess the conditions your finished work will face and choose markers that provide the necessary level of durability.
